Nhtml xhtml & css for dummies pdf download

Mar 12, 2020 since xhtml is really just html refined under xmls rules, it offers three document type definitions dtd that duplicate those of html version four. Also note that links on the web are notoriously ephemeral. Html2xhtml is a commandline tool that converts html files to xhtml files. Web design with html, css, javascript and jquery set. This book is a simple and comprehensive guide dedicated to helping beginners learn html and css. Jun 24, 2005 this is a class library that helps you produce valid xhtml from html. Xhtml2xhtml tries always to generate valid xhtml files. The item will be bolded if it is a requirement for xhtml compliant code to be changed, since xhtml will otherwise usually work as html, at least if its full features are constrained. Xhtml was derived from html to conform to xml standards.

Html vs xhtml find out the 8 most useful differences. Xhtml combines html and xml into a single format html 4. Html xhtml css for dummies 7th edition book is available in pdf formate. A complete and fully updated reference for these key web technologies html, xhtml, and css are essential tools for creating dynamic web sites. Internet applications, id54 seminar 1, html and css task 2 create html and css les to implement the tasty recipes web site according to the requirements speci ed. Difference between html and xhtml difference between. Editors sources for images and graphics tools can be found below. Html is seamlessly transformed into documents you can print, download and archive. Beginning html, xhtml, css and javascript is available for free download in pdf format. Aug 03, 2019 this xhtml header tags resource is a work in progress, perpetually expanding and evolving as new information is obtained, explored, and integrated. I invite you to browse through the table of contents, or check the full index.

However, the root element name continues to be html even in the xhtml specified html. Outlining the fundamentals, this guide works through all. Complete beginning html, xhtml, css, and javascript html, xhtml, and css, sixth edition html, xhtml and css allinone for dummies html. The newest edition of this bestselling guide is fully updated. It lists the elements available for each xhtml dtd, their content rules, attributes, etc. The xhtmlpedia is a browsable list of xhtml elements and attributes. Xhtml documents look more professional and eradicate sloppy coding habits.

Subscribe for a membership to access all its features, anytime for the price of two beers. Hence xhtml is strict when compared to html and does not allow user to get away with lapses in coding and structure. You can use this library to clean the bulky html that microsoft word documents produce when converted to html. Examples might be simplified to improve reading and basic understanding.

Try out and download all of the code for this book online at. This html code works fine in most browsers even if it does not follow the html rules. Downloads and links beginning html5 and css3 for dummies. A great use for this kind of link is on software and pdf download pages. It goes over all the basicfundamentals of html and xhtml, including the rules and properties of css. This is a converter to transform html specific areas into xhtml for your pages and for your site. Html xhtml and css bible 5th edition is available for free download in pdf format.

The toolbar is a small and fast download, and it makes web development a lot. Html5, html, xhtml, and dhtml free computer, programming. You are using the free demo of the online wysiwyg html editor by htmlg which is the best web content composer software. The type attribute specifies the type of form control to be created. Html was an excellent language for displaying simple text and images on the screen.

Xhtml is an xml language based on html, with the exactly the same power but a more regular syntax that can be processed by xml tools. Html xhtml css for dummies 7th edition programming book. Xhtml extensible html a markup language for web pages from the w3c. Beginning html, xhtml, css, and javascript by jon duckett. I wanted to take a different approach, teaching both languages at the same time so that you can see the fruits of your labor sooner rather than later. Both languages are accepted by current browsers this page is xhtml. Like the bestselling first edition, html, xhtml, and css allinone for dummies, 2nd edition makes it easy to grasp the fundamentals and start building effective web pages. Html xhtml and css bible 5th edition engineering books pdf. You can think of these as the punctuation rules for xhtml. It gives you an insight on javascript but does not go to far into it. The indispensable introductory reference guide to html, xhtml and css. Xhtml, extensible hypertext markup language, is an application of html that is also a valid xml document, as opposed to standard html which is based on sgml. Html, xhtml and css allinone for dummies by andy harris.

It also provides tag and attribute filtering support. These free css html templates can be freely downloaded. Free pdf books, download books, free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development. Also the web page can be seen in different web browsers to check browser compability with web page. Chapter 2 meeting the structure and components of html. Download the code examples from beginning html5 and css3 for dummies below, or view the downloads for previous editions of html for dummies here. Thats why we completely rethought the tech book to make it accessible, relevant, and attractive to a whole new group of readers.

Cascading style sheets css allow a programmer to create and apply various styles, such as color and formatting, to text and web page layout. Following is the comparison table between html vs xhtml. Fast and easy xhtml xhtml tutorial website tips at. This content was uploaded by our users and we assume good faith they have the permission to share this book. Because xhtml and html are closely related, they are sometimes documented in parallel. I came out of my bookwriting retirement to write webkit for dummies in 2011. Like xml, xhtml can be extended with proprietary tags. A tool to convert a variety of inputs into normalized, tagged, xhtml with embeddedlinked svg and png where appropriate. Pdf download web design with html, css, javascript and jquery set ebook read online 1. Unlike html, xhtml pages have a strict syntax and needs to be well formed in order to be parsed using xml parsers. So, even if the xhtml specification permits the div element to contain text and inline elements, it is better practice to enclose text and inline elements in meaningful block elements such as p, ol, ul, dl, h1 to h6, blockquote, etc. Even though new technologies enable people to do much more with the web, in the end html, xhtml and css are still at the root of any web site. Html, css, api does everybody know what these elements are. In the pdf file some texts colors are different from html file.

Cascading style sheets css is a style sheet language describing the appearance formatting of an html document like background images, font styles and sizes. Html, xhtml and css allinone for dummies, 2nd edition. You can specify exactly which tags and attributes are allowed in the output and the other tags are filtered out. Xhtml is the extended version of widely used hypertext markup language html and designed to work with the extensible markup language, or xml. Many books that teach html and css resemble dull manuals. It is able to correct many common errors in input html files without loose of infor. Buy html, xhtml and css allinone for dummies 2nd revised edition by harris, andy isbn. You can contribute or contact me through the github page of html2xhtml. This is due to the fact that xhtml was derived from html just to conform with xml standards. Also like xml, xhtml must be coded more rigorously than html. This book teaches you what you are suppose to know about htmlxhtml. Nov 09, 2015 html and xhtml hypertext markup language sl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Creating a web page using html, xhtml, and css module 6 copyright 2010 third house inc.

Convert html to xhtml and clean unnecessary tags and. Check out the authors highlights of html5 and css3 pdf. Bug reports may be filed at the issue tracker of html2xhtml in github. Working with the team at wiley was a great experience, and contributing to the for dummies series is quite an honor for me. When ed asked me to step in as his coauthor for beginning html5 and css3 for dummies, i replied yes. However, xhtml is also descended from xml, which is a scripting language with much stricter grammar rules than html, and xhtml has inherited some of that discipline. Comparing htmlhypertext markup language and xhtml extensible html could be like comparing identical twins since there are only a few minor points which we can actually point out as being different. It can also handle invalid or non wellformed xhtml input, and clean it to produce a wellformed and valid xhtml output. Hypertext markup language html and its cousin, xhtml, along with the cascading style sheet css language are the lifeblood of web pages.

Xhtml stands for extensible hypertext markup language. Html, xhtml and css allinone for dummies harris, andy on. The namespace name xhtml is intended for use in various specifications such as recommendations. The book also contains a fullcolor color chart, tables of both xhtml and css, a complete list of the entity references for special symbols and characters, and a table of hexadecimal values. Css style rules for html documents html markup tags that structure docs browsers read them and display according to rules api. Html xhtml css for dummies 7th edition book free pdf books. Now a set of best practices has emerged using html or xhtml to create your basic web pages, css to control their appearance and make them look attractive, and javascript to add interactivity.

It was very easy to learn and it allowed beginners to pick the language up and start building web pages right away. The column on guidance for xhtml html compatibility lists ways in which a document can be crafted to work in either xhtml or html. This tutorial helps beginners learn the basics of creating web sites using html and css.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java and xml. If you continue browsing the site, you agree to the use of cookies on this website. Difference between dhtml and xhtml difference between. Html, css, and javascript mobile development for dummies. The following table lists the css attributes you will use the most. What is extensible hypertext markup language xhtml. About the tutorial css is used to control the style of a web document in a simple and easy way.

They still allow us to develop pages for older browsers, however, by using the transitional dtd declaration. The design of programming books has traditionally been quite intimidating and uninspiring. Xhtml syntax is very similar to html syntax and almost all the valid html elements are valid in xhtml as well. It is the next step in the evolution of the internet. But when you write an xhtml document, you need to pay a bit extra attention to make your html document compliant to xhtml. Extensible hypertext markup language xhtml is a hybrid language between xml and html and is also an accepted standard in the coding world. This is the first step in creating web pages, and even a bit of knowledge will help you tweak your business website, blog, newsletter and more. Tools a list of links to the tools mentioned in this book. Clean, wellformed and commented tableless code utf8 encoding. Beginning html, xhtml, css and javascript engineering books. The path of the html input file can be provided as a command line argument.

The free website templates that are showcased here are open source, creative commons or totally free. This app is a html generator and the code is created for you. They rightly fell out of favor in html 4 and xhtml 1 because of their presentational. In xhtml, the documents should have one root element. Xhtml was developed by combining the strengths of html and xml. Aug 27, 2006 emil stenstrom html xhtml is often mentioned when you talk about web standards of different kinds, and many believe that its the future of the web. The previous editions were called html, xhtml, and css all in one for. This means there are some changes from the way youve normally written your html files.

W3schools is optimized for learning, testing, and training. The xmlns attribute is required in xhtml, but is invalid in html. This friendly, allinone guide covers what programmers need to know about each of the technologies and how to use them together. This web site is the companion to our book, and contains hundreds of html and css examples from the chapters in usable form including working html5 and css3 pages plus pointers to interesting widgets that you can use to embellish your own documents and astound your friends. The rules covered here are the rules for making your document wellformed. You might be interested in reading the opinions of others. Best of all, youll learn html and css in a way that wont put you to sleep. Ml tutorials, css tutorials and tips, website tips at xml prolog tells the browser that your document is based upon a dtd using xml, and that its using a standard character encoding. Hyper hyper is a free and open source terminal built on web technologies with the goal of creating a beaut.

Which are collected from different web resources for users. Html and xhtml are both languages in which web pages are written. It is not, nor is it intended to be, a comprehensive list of available tags. Html, xhtml, and css are the key technologies for building dynamic web pages. Css html notepad is easy to use app which helps in creating web pages. Xhtml tutorial understanding difference between html and xhtml.

Pdf download web design with html, css, javascript and. Your contribution will go a long way in helping us serve. Xhtml is very similar to html as both are descendants of a language called sgml. This document therefore uses the phrase xhtml to refer to xhtml 1. Html tags html elements web browsers html page structure html versions the declaration declarations topic 2. That is to say, xhtml follows the xml rulebook for markup. Even better, perhaps you will share any complimentary or critical information concerning the contents of this article. A dtd is a detailed description of the elements of a markup language, including when, where, and how it can be used, as well as any associated attributes. This meant that authors had to follow some new, more strict rules about writing markup. One of the hardest things to do with your site is to modify its pages to conform to the xhtml strict dtd.

Contribute to loicmahieupdfkitjs development by creating an account on github. Here are the important points to remember while writing a new. Its quick and simple to convert html to pdf with prince. We also explain the differences between html 4 and xhtml, so you can decide if you want to stick.

Fast and easy xhtml, xhtml tutorial, html, web standards, by shirley. If you are just starting to learn, you should learn xhtml. Since the web was first created, the languages used to build web sites have been constantly evolving. Details regarding the proper use of xhtml are at the end of this document. Xhtml is in many ways similar to html, but it is more stricter and cleaner than html. This tutorial covers both the versions css1 and css2 and gives a complete understanding of css, starting from its basics to advanced concepts. Html5 and css3 for dummies by andy harris engineering books. The emphasis is on scholarly publicatuions but much of the technology is general. Html can travel over the network to a browser either in html syntax or an xml syntax called xhtml. Now that we understand what css does, lets discuss more about how it works. Download pdf of html5 and css3 allinone for dummies 3rd edition by. There is no problem to generate pdf file from the html file, but i can not read css block i guess. In xhtml, the tags and attributes can be described in lower case only.

1538 650 108 315 1474 1525 371 1387 369 1350 1585 1393 82 1525 96 1100 361 1517 1395 1231 579 452 1239 1053 687 929 620 1297 564 141 1135 1334 343 1470 321 853 603 125 619 1100 377 626 702 1220 738 1448 895 1124